SafeSport is authorized by Congress to review and respond to reports of sexual misconduct in Olympic and\u00a0Paralympic sports.<\/p>\n<p class=\"uiTextSmall f aic jcc\">Article continues below this ad<\/p>\n<p>The nonprofit declared Garcia &#8220;permanently ineligible&#8221; because of criminal charges for sexual misconduct involving minors, SafeSport records indicate.<\/p>\n<p>In November, two Bexar County grand juries indicted Garcia on nine counts of aggravated sexual assault of a child, six counts of sexual abuse of a child and one count of indecency with a child through sexual contact.<\/p>\n<p>He was arrested Nov. 13 and released from the Bexar County jail after posting a $200,000 bond. He ended up behind bars again on\u00a0Dec. 5, when he was arrested on a misdemeanor family violence charge of indecent assault.<\/p>\n<p>An affidavit supporting Garcia&#8217;s December arrest says the grand jury indictments stem from his alleged sexual abuse years earlier of at least one youth athlete at his boxing gym.<\/p>\n<p class=\"uiTextSmall f aic jcc\">Article continues below this ad<\/p>\n<p>According to the affidavit, a 31-year-old woman contacted police in 2025 and reported that Garcia\u00a0sexually assaulted her on Feb. 25 of that year and had also abused her when she was 12 or 13 and he was her boxing coach. She had remained in contact with Garcia, his family and the San Antonio boxing community into adulthood.<\/p>\n<p>Describing the alleged February 2025 assault, the woman told police she watched a boxing match with Garcia and her friends and went to Garcia&#8217;s home in North-Central San Antonio afterward. She and Garcia sat at a table and began talking. During the conversation, Garcia allegedly pulled the woman toward him and began touching her breast. She asked him to stop and he did not.<\/p>\n<p>The woman told Garcia that &#8220;his sexual abuse ruined her life,&#8221; the arrest affidavit says.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;We&#8217;re cool,&#8221; Garcia responded, according to the woman.<\/p>\n<p class=\"uiTextSmall f aic jcc\">Article continues below this ad<\/p>\n<p>The affidavit states that Garcia was previously indicted on criminal charges related to his alleged sexual abuse of the same woman when she was a child.<\/p>\n<p>Garcia was released from jail on the indecent assault charge on Dec. 6 after posting a $10,000 bond. He is awaiting trial on that charge and the\u00a0child sexual abuse charges, according to court records.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Records do not reveal where Garcia coached when the alleged abuse happened.<\/p>\n<p>Sunset Boxing on\u00a0the East Side\u00a0featured him <a href=\"https:\/\/www.instagram.com\/p\/DGuGQOFx7bv\/\" data-link=\"native\" class=\"\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">in an Instagram post<\/a> in March 2025.\u00a0A\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.expressnews.com\/sports\/other-sports\/boxing\/article\/Boxing-and-San-Antonio-A-glove-affair-11107786.php\" data-link=\"native\" class=\"\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">2017 article in the San Antonio Express-News<\/a> says Garcia was a promoter for boxing matches staged at Last Chance Ministries, a church and community service organization on the West Side.<\/p>\n<p class=\"uiTextSmall f aic jcc\">Article continues below this ad<\/p>\n<p>Garcia was a material examiner and forklift driver with the Defense Logistics Agency, an arm of the Defense Department, and worked\u00a0for the federal government for 28 years, according to\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.dla.mil\/About-DLA\/News\/News-Article-View\/Article\/4059836\/employee-spotlight-jose-garcia\/\" data-link=\"native\" class=\"\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">an interview posted on the agency&#8217;s website<\/a> on Feb. 7, 2025.<\/p>\n<p>In the interview, Garcia said he grew up boxing and coached five days a week when he wasn&#8217;t working his day job. He said that at the time, he was\u00a0coaching three professional fighters and 10 amateurs.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;I love being a mentor, tutor, counselor, big brother, and father figure to my boxers, &#8220;he said. &#8220;I also enjoy teaching them the importance of following through in life.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p class=\"uiTextSmall f aic jcc\">Article continues below this ad<\/p>\n<p><script async src=\"\/\/www.instagram.com\/embed.js\"><\/script><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"Longtime San Antonio boxing coach Jose Angel Garcia, 67, faces 16 felony charges stemming from alleged child sexual&hellip;\n","protected":false},"author":2,"featured_media":410188,"comment_status":"","ping_status":"","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[8],"tags":[82,84,83],"class_list":["post-410187","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","category-san-antonio","tag-san-antonio","tag-san-antonio-headlines","tag-san-antonio-news"],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/410187","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/2"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=410187"}],"version-history":[{"count":0,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/410187\/revisions"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/410188"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=410187"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=410187"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/us-tx\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=410187"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
